Tax Senior - Sustainability, Climate & Equity - Renewable Energy Position Summary: Deloitte Tax LLP (Deloitte Tax) is currently seeking a Tax Senior to join our Business Tax Services (BTS) practice, which provides tax services to clients in over 150 countries and regions worldwide. This role will specifically focus on serving renewable energy clients who develop, build, own, and operate renewable energy projects. The ideal candidate will have a passion for sustainability and renewable energy and be willing to learn and adapt to the growing industry. This is an exciting opportunity to work with a team of experienced professionals in a rapidly growing practice. Responsibilities: - Advise clients on tax issues related to renewable energy projects - Work closely with an experienced team and collaborate with colleagues across all member firms - Identify and advise clients on potential benefits and eligibility requirements for various renewable energy tax credits - Prepare tax returns and provide advisory services related to renewable energy tax equity structures - Maintain and develop strong internal and client relationships - Monitor legislative and regulatory tax developments and present potential opportunities to assist clients - Support various internal initiatives and special tax projects Qualifications: - Bachelor's degree in accounting, finance, law, business administration, economics, or related field - 3+ years of experience in a related field - Ability to travel up to 25%, as needed - Strong analytical and research skills - Effective verbal and written communication skills - Proven leadership skills and ability to collaborate with others - Experience with Microsoft Office Suite, especially Excel - Active CPA, licensed attorney, enrolled agent, or other relevant certifications preferred - Advanced degree (Masters of Tax, JD, or LLM) a plus - Strong organizational and time management skills - Experience working in a virtual and/or global environment - Passion for leveraging technology and exploring new solutions - Previous Big 4 or large CPA or law firm experience preferred Salary Information: - The disclosed wage range for this role is $63,420 to $144,300, taking into account factors such as skill sets, experience, and certifications. - Eligible for participation in a discretionary annual incentive program, subject to program rules and individual performance.
